Problems solved by technology

[0002] For unmanned vending equipment, when replenishing the goods, the administrator needs to register the product information before the replenishment, so as to report to the vending equipment product management system after the replenishment is completed, which increases a lot of human labor and is prone to errors; For the corresponding data of the vending equipment commodity management system, it needs to be manually entered or imported through external files when replenishing goods, which is not conducive to the rapid update and iterative business growth needs of system data, and there is a waste of redundant human resources; And, when adding new goods, you can only add goods according to the corresponding position of the old commodity price label. What you need to do is precise and refined operation. If you encounter new types of goods, you need to add additional price labels or replace the old ones. cumbersome operations such as price tags, poor reusability

Abstract

The invention discloses self-service equipment, replenishment management method and device of the self-service equipment, a server and a replenishment management system. The self-service equipment comprises an equipment body, a door, at least one layer of shelf and a weighing device for weighing goods on each shelf. The replenishment management method comprises the steps as follows: weight information of goods on each shelf after replenishment this time is acquired; the replenishing weight of each layer of shelf this time is calculated according to the weight information of goods on the shelfafter replenishment this time and weight information of goods on the shelf before replenishment this time; goods information replenished this time is sorted out according to the replenishment weight this time and SKU (stock keeping unit) information of pre-stored goods; the goods information replenished this time is recorded in a good management database. Automatic management of replenishment information of the self-service equipment can be realized, the labor cost can be saved, and the self-service equipment is more efficient.
